Smoking's Link to Back Problems

Smoking causes cancer, lung disease and heart attacks, and disrupts body chemistry in such dangerous ways that a host of other ailments can result. So it's not surprising that even back problems might be caused by nicotine and smoke ingestion. Indeed, the American Academy of Orthopaedic Surgeons (AAOS) says smoking diminishes the blood supply to the bones, and saps them of calcium, both of which increase the possibility of the onset of osteoporosis. Suggestive of the relationship between smoking and back issues, one's chances for success after back surgery improve dramatically if one is a nonsmoker or has ceased smoking.

Low Back Pain Recovery Slow and Uncertain

Current clinical practice guidelines state that 90% of acute lower back pain patients will recover within four to six weeks, with or without treatment. However, new research published in The British Medical Journal has found that recovery from low back pain is much slower than previously thought. Australian researchers from The George Insitute studied patients with acute low back pain for a year. The results from the study found that even with treatment, after two months only half of the patients had recovered from the original episode of pain. After about one year, 40% were still reporting that their back was still causing them pain.

Only Exercise Found to Prevent Low-Back Problems

Exercise in workplace and community environments is excellent in halting low-back problems, while a variety of other popular interventions have little if any beneficial effect, according to a recent review of a number of high-scientific-quality clinical trials. Doctors Cautiously Endorse Cerebrospinal-Fluid Pain Therapy

Injecting painkillers into the thin layer of fluid surrounding the brain and spinal cord can be effective in relieving pain and restoring function, but there are many risks associated with the procedure, which should be used only as a last resort, specialists said.


The physicians, who spoke at a meeting of the American Academy of Pain Medicine, criticized the freewheeling use of pain medications and technologies, which include implantable, programmable pumps and catheters to deliver the drugs.

Stem Cells Can Aid Spinal Disc Repair

A study using a handful of large animals strongly suggests that stem cells transferred from the body's own fat can facilitate the repair of damaged spinal discs. Stem cell treatments appeared to increase disc tissue density, concentration of disc matrix proteins between the disc cells, and disc water content.

A Step Toward Overcoming Paralysis

U.S. scientists have created a machine that allows the brain cells of paralyzed monkeys to circumvent a simulated damaged spinal cord and move muscles well enough to play a computer game. The University of Washington researchers, led by Chet Moritz and Eberhard Fetz, used a computer-controlled device to stimulate chemically immobilized muscles. Not only cells in the motor cortex - the brain area that controls movement - were investigated, but sensory cells, too. And they worked equally well. In fact, the scientists found that two-thirds of the neurons they tried could be utilized to move musculature.

The Progression of Spinal Decompression

Spinal Decompression has had many technological milestones. Some early tables were just straight pulley tables which were slightly more advanced than traction because they were software driven, yet they would only allow a set amount of pressure. Over time, spinal decompression tables were developed to have a ramp up and ramp down speed of distraction - making for a much smoother experience for the patient. Later advances followed in the form of belting and improved patient comfort.

What is Spinal Decompression Therapy?

Spinal Decompression is a non-invasive, non-surgical technology where a patient is placed onto an instrument which belts them in and separates their lower body from their upper body. This allows for pressure to be relieved on certain joints and structures in either the lumbar or cervical regions of the spine. The treatment lasts about 15 to 20 minutes, depending on the type of device being used. Patients are usually placed on a protocol that is software driven.

One Simple Solution to Neck Pain: Good Posture

Treating and preventing chronic neck pain can often be successfully accomplished by something as simple as adopting correct posture while waking and sleeping. While the pain sufferer can treat the symptoms of frequent neck "cricks" with neck stretch exercises, painkillers or ice applications, the symptoms' root causes must be dealt with differently. These root causes often involve some kind of poor posture, says Dr. Brian Bruel, an assistant professor of physical medicine and rehabilitation on the one hand, and anesthesiology and pain management on the other, at the University of Texas Southwestern Medical Center. Posture violators might crouch over a desk all day long, slouch on a sofa while watching TV, or contort themselves while reading.
